Title:
  ubuntu-drivers-common fails to find any Drivers for my graphics card
  (jockey-text does)

Status in “ubuntu-drivers-common” package in Ubuntu:
  Incomplete

Bug description:
  Had this problem since I change motherboards recently, the system gui
  and the terminal fail to find drivers to use with my system. On the
  old motherboard this worked without issue.

  I did have an Asus P8Z77-V Pro to an AsRock Z77 Extreme4 (same chipset
  and general features)

  I see that jockey-common is an old package in 14.04 so I am stuck on
  13.10 until I can use ubuntu-drivers-common to find my system drivers.

  'jockey-text -l' output:
  noki@grandslam:~$ jockey-text -l
  kmod:nvidia_319_updates - nvidia_319_updates (Proprietary, Enabled, Not in 
use)
  kmod:nvidia_304 - NVIDIA binary Xorg driver, kernel module and VDPAU library 
(Proprietary, Disabled, Not in use)
  kmod:nvidia_304_updates - NVIDIA binary Xorg driver, kernel module and VDPAU 
library (Proprietary, Disabled, Not in use)
  kmod:nvidia_319 - NVIDIA binary Xorg driver, kernel module and VDPAU library 
(Proprietary, Disabled, Not in use)
  noki@grandslam:~$ 

  'ubuntu-drivers list' output:
  noki@grandslam:~$ ubuntu-drivers list

  noki@grandslam:~$

  This all works fine on my second PC, and my laptop using the same
  various version of Ubuntu (from 13 to 14)
